The Jacksonville Jaguars will open up training camp on July 25, meaning that watching guys run around on a football field is only just a few weeks away. More importantly however, it means it's just a few weeks away from being able to watch them run around on the football field under the new regime.
The Jaguars will have a total of eight practices open to the public, including a scrimmage at EverBank Field on August 3.
The following dates and times will be open to the public:
July 26 - 9:55 a.m.
July 27 - 9:55 a.m.
July 28 - 9:55 a.m.
July 29 - 9:55 a.m.
July 31 - 9:55 a.m. (first day of pads)
Aug. 1 - 9:55 a.m.
Aug. 2 - 9:55 a.m.
Aug. 3 - 6:45 p.m. - Scrimmage inside EverBank Field
Admission and parking to the practices are free.
